Was slapped by party leader Pawan Pandey at CM's residence: SP MLC Ashu Malik

LUCKNOW: As Acrimony, bitter exchanges and personal attacks marked a meeting of Samajwadi Party leaders, MLC Ashu Malik today said that he was slapped by a party leader at chief minister's residence. "Chief minister Akhilesh Yadav had called me to clarify things related to a news article published in an English daily wherein Akhilesh Yadav was referred to as Aurangzeb and SP Chief Mulayam Singh as Shahjahan," Malik told ABP News "When I was at CM's residence, party leader Pawan Pandey came and attacked me. He slapped me twice," he said. "I was asked to show up as the chief minister wanted to clarify things related to the news article in front of people but my presence was misunderstood by others," he added. Malik said that Akhilesh Yadav was not present at his residence when the incident took place. Today's political drama was also punctuated by other clashes between rival factions outside and inside the venue and after the abrupt end to the meeting of the legislators, MPs and ministers. The Shivpal and Akhilesh factions within the once united party came to blows ahead of the meeting called by Mulayam Singh, who made it clear that he would never let go either his brother Shivpal Yadav or long-time aide Amar Singh, who the Chief Minister intensely dislikes. Earlier, in a choking voice, Akhilesh Yadav said his father was his "guru" and he would never split the Samajwadi Party. He said he was ready to quit if his father asked him -- to end the turmoil in the party. The 43-year-old, however, alleged a conspiracy against him and that Shivpal Yadav was a part of it.
